In the work Egyptian recruits crossing the desert of Jean-Léon Gérôme, painted in 1857, the spectator was transported to the heart of a desert landscape imbued with mystery and tension. At that time, Gérôme asserted itself as a master of realism, skillfully merging a refined technique with a deep understanding of humanity. The work testifies to its exceptional talent to capture movement and emotion, illustrating soldiers on a burning sky, passing by dunes which evoke the struggle and determination.
This emblematic piece, which aroused strong discussions when it came out, continues to resonate in the world of contemporary art, even influencing modern graphic design. The palette of earthy colors and the dynamic brushstones of Gérôme give the work a dramatic intensity, making each look at this Art print unique.
